/device/generic/goldfish/keymaster/ |
trusty_keymaster_device.h | 46 keymaster_error_t configure(const keymaster_key_param_set_t* params); 48 keymaster_error_t generate_key(const keymaster_key_param_set_t* params, 55 keymaster_error_t import_key(const keymaster_key_param_set_t* params, 64 const keymaster_key_param_set_t* attest_params, 67 const keymaster_key_param_set_t* upgrade_params, 70 const keymaster_key_param_set_t* in_params, 71 keymaster_key_param_set_t* out_params, 74 const keymaster_key_param_set_t* in_params, 76 keymaster_key_param_set_t* out_params, keymaster_blob_t* output); 78 const keymaster_key_param_set_t* in_params [all...] |
trusty_keymaster_device.cpp | 162 keymaster_error_t TrustyKeymasterDevice::configure(const keymaster_key_param_set_t* params) { 199 const keymaster_key_param_set_t* params, keymaster_key_blob_t* key_blob, 271 const keymaster_key_param_set_t* params, keymaster_key_format_t key_format, 355 const keymaster_key_param_set_t* attest_params, 418 const keymaster_key_param_set_t* upgrade_params, 454 const keymaster_key_param_set_t* in_params, 455 keymaster_key_param_set_t* out_params, 497 const keymaster_key_param_set_t* in_params, 500 keymaster_key_param_set_t* out_params, 559 const keymaster_key_param_set_t* in_params [all...] |
/system/core/trusty/keymaster/ |
trusty_keymaster_device.h | 46 keymaster_error_t configure(const keymaster_key_param_set_t* params); 48 keymaster_error_t generate_key(const keymaster_key_param_set_t* params, 55 keymaster_error_t import_key(const keymaster_key_param_set_t* params, 64 const keymaster_key_param_set_t* attest_params, 67 const keymaster_key_param_set_t* upgrade_params, 70 const keymaster_key_param_set_t* in_params, 71 keymaster_key_param_set_t* out_params, 74 const keymaster_key_param_set_t* in_params, 76 keymaster_key_param_set_t* out_params, keymaster_blob_t* output); 78 const keymaster_key_param_set_t* in_params [all...] |
trusty_keymaster_device.cpp | 168 keymaster_error_t TrustyKeymasterDevice::configure(const keymaster_key_param_set_t* params) { 209 const keymaster_key_param_set_t* params, keymaster_key_blob_t* key_blob, 280 const keymaster_key_param_set_t* params, keymaster_key_format_t key_format, 364 const keymaster_key_param_set_t* attest_params, 427 const keymaster_key_param_set_t* upgrade_params, 463 const keymaster_key_param_set_t* in_params, 464 keymaster_key_param_set_t* out_params, 506 const keymaster_key_param_set_t* in_params, 509 keymaster_key_param_set_t* out_params, 568 const keymaster_key_param_set_t* in_params [all...] |
trusty_keymaster_main.cpp | 116 keymaster_key_param_set_t ec_param_set = {ec_params, sizeof(ec_params) / sizeof(*ec_params)}; 128 keymaster_key_param_set_t rsa_param_set = {rsa_params, sizeof(rsa_params) / sizeof(*rsa_params)}; 145 keymaster_key_param_set_t param_set = {params, sizeof(params) / sizeof(*params)};
|
/hardware/libhardware/include/hardware/ |
keymaster2.h | 59 const keymaster_key_param_set_t* params); 113 const keymaster_key_param_set_t* params, 187 const keymaster_key_param_set_t* params, 241 const keymaster_key_param_set_t* attest_params, 262 const keymaster_key_param_set_t* upgrade_params, 334 const keymaster_key_param_set_t* in_params, 335 keymaster_key_param_set_t* out_params, 378 const keymaster_key_param_set_t* in_params, 380 keymaster_key_param_set_t* out_params, keymaster_blob_t* output); 407 const keymaster_key_param_set_t* in_params [all...] |
keymaster1.h | 283 const keymaster_key_param_set_t* params, 358 const keymaster_key_param_set_t* params, 453 const keymaster_key_param_set_t* in_params, 454 keymaster_key_param_set_t* out_params, 497 const keymaster_key_param_set_t* in_params, 499 keymaster_key_param_set_t* out_params, keymaster_blob_t* output); 523 const keymaster_key_param_set_t* in_params, 525 keymaster_key_param_set_t* out_params, keymaster_blob_t* output);
|
keymaster_defs.h | 321 } keymaster_key_param_set_t; typedef in typeref:struct:__anon43247 331 keymaster_key_param_set_t hw_enforced; 332 keymaster_key_param_set_t sw_enforced; 607 inline void keymaster_free_param_set(keymaster_key_param_set_t* set) {
|
/system/keymaster/include/keymaster/ |
soft_keymaster_device.h | 139 const keymaster_key_param_set_t* params, 148 const keymaster_key_param_set_t* params, 164 const keymaster_key_param_set_t* in_params, 165 keymaster_key_param_set_t* out_params, 169 const keymaster_key_param_set_t* in_params, 171 keymaster_key_param_set_t* out_params, 175 const keymaster_key_param_set_t* in_params, 177 keymaster_key_param_set_t* out_params, 184 const keymaster_key_param_set_t* params); 188 const keymaster_key_param_set_t* params [all...] |
authorization_set.h | 31 * An extension of the keymaster_key_param_set_t struct, which provides serialization memory 34 class AuthorizationSet : public Serializable, public keymaster_key_param_set_t { 61 explicit AuthorizationSet(const keymaster_key_param_set_t& set) : indirect_data_(nullptr) { 122 bool Reinitialize(const keymaster_key_param_set_t& set) { 171 void Union(const keymaster_key_param_set_t& set); 176 void Difference(const keymaster_key_param_set_t& set); 179 * Returns the data in a keymaster_key_param_set_t, suitable for returning to C code. For C 183 void CopyToParamSet(keymaster_key_param_set_t* set) const; 380 bool push_back(const keymaster_key_param_set_t& set); 469 keymaster_key_param_t*& elems_ = keymaster_key_param_set_t::params [all...] |
/system/keymaster/ |
soft_keymaster_device.cpp | 377 bool FindTagValue(const keymaster_key_param_set_t& params, 616 const keymaster_key_param_set_t* params) { 739 const keymaster1_device_t* dev, const keymaster_key_param_set_t* params, 785 const keymaster_key_param_set_t* params, [all...] |
android_keymaster_test_utils.cpp | 238 keymaster_key_param_set_t out_params; 249 keymaster_key_param_set_t out_params; 269 keymaster_key_param_set_t out_params; 285 keymaster_key_param_set_t out_params; 315 keymaster_key_param_set_t out_params; 710 static bool all_digests_supported(const keymaster_key_param_set_t* params) { 719 get_algorithm_param(const keymaster_key_param_set_t* params) { [all...] |
authorization_set.cpp | 182 void AuthorizationSet::Union(const keymaster_key_param_set_t& set) { 190 void AuthorizationSet::Difference(const keymaster_key_param_set_t& set) { 208 void AuthorizationSet::CopyToParamSet(keymaster_key_param_set_t* set) const { 269 bool AuthorizationSet::push_back(const keymaster_key_param_set_t& set) {
|
/system/security/keystore/ |
legacy_keymaster_device_wrapper.cpp | 67 class KmParamSet : public keymaster_key_param_set_t { 109 KmParamSet(KmParamSet&& other) : keymaster_key_param_set_t{other.params, other.length} { 158 static inline hidl_vec<KeyParameter> kmParamSet2Hidl(const keymaster_key_param_set_t& set) { 440 keymaster_key_param_set_t out_params{nullptr, 0}; 469 keymaster_key_param_set_t out_params = {}; 502 keymaster_key_param_set_t out_params = {};
|
/system/vold/tests/ |
CryptfsScryptHidlizationEquivalence_test.cpp | 180 keymaster_key_param_set_t param_set = { params, sizeof(params)/sizeof(*params) }; 302 keymaster_key_param_set_t param_set = { params, sizeof(params)/sizeof(*params) };
|
/hardware/interfaces/keymaster/3.0/default/ |
KeymasterDevice.cpp | 224 class KmParamSet : public keymaster_key_param_set_t { 266 KmParamSet(KmParamSet&& other) : keymaster_key_param_set_t{other.params, other.length} { 315 static inline hidl_vec<KeyParameter> kmParamSet2Hidl(const keymaster_key_param_set_t& set) { 635 keymaster_key_param_set_t out_params{nullptr, 0}; 663 keymaster_key_param_set_t out_params{nullptr, 0}; 695 keymaster_key_param_set_t out_params{nullptr, 0};
|